To store lubricants safely and maintain their quality, follow these tips:
- Temperature Control: Keep lubricants in a cool, dry environment to prevent degradation from heat or moisture.
- Seal Containers Properly: Ensure containers are tightly sealed to avoid contamination and oxidation.
- Avoid Mixing: Do not mix different types of lubricants as this can affect their performance.
- Organise Storage: Label containers clearly and store them in designated areas to avoid confusion.
- Regular Inspection: Check for signs of contamination or degradation before use.
Proper storage ensures that lubricants remain effective and safe for use.
